A successful video is aware of who it’s talking to. You may have already got a firm understanding of who your viewers is, dalfak what they like, and the way they think. If that’s the case then articulate it right here. If not, it’s time to do some viewers research. Go beyond just discovering out their basic age, gender and placement. What are their commonest issues, questions and interests? What do they connect with? Who are their influences? Conduct interviews, ask for suggestions, trawl your social media pages to seek out out who’s connecting with your model and ask them questions.

To measure the success of your video, you’ll wish to find a way to track it and feed it into your analytics platform. Paid platforms like Wistia have tracking capabilities built-in. With platforms like YouTube and Fb, you may have to trace them individually or try one thing like Google Analytics. The principle point is to ensure you have got a way to measure how your video has carried out towards its targets and whether it generated constructive or detrimental ROI. Measuring issues like watch instances (how lengthy folks watched the video) and click-by way of charges (how many individuals clicked on in-video links) can be useful for making significant modifications to the way you produce your videos in the future.
